Administrative Assistant
Do you have an administrative background with a passion for people? Do you enjoy using your superior customer service, problem-solving, planning, organizational and communication skills to ensure your success and the success of those around you? If so, this may be the perfect opportunity for you!
Pacific Western Transportation is currently seeking an Administrative Assistant to support the day-to-day operation of its corporate office.
This individual must be able to interact with staff (at all levels), while remaining flexible, proactive, resourceful, and efficient. A high level of professionalism and confidentiality are expected at all times.
Core Duties and Responsibilities
- Reception – front line contact for incoming calls and visitors; monitor and admit visitors through locked main office entrance
- Arrange meetings, appointments, and room bookings, as well as catering needs and any other specific requirements
- Prepare invoices, cheques and various paperwork for signature, mail, and courier
- Assist finance department with Accounts Payable and Receivable
- Order office supplies, stationary postage meter refills, etc.
- Coordinate various vendors including office cleaners, landscapers, carpet/window cleaners
- Prepare and/or edit internal and external letters, memos, and emails
- Ensure that various administrative tasks are done in an effective and efficient manner, including reviewing outside mail, drafting correspondence, and screening phone calls
- Assign and activate fuel cards
- Organize various annual corporate events
- Order and distribute birthday and holiday cards for employees
- Renew corporate vehicle licenses annually
- Maintain strict confidentiality and discretion in all aspects of the position
